Job Overview
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Registered Nurse to join our colorectal team as an Associate Band 6 Clinical Nurse Specialist. Working alongside the Band 7 colorectal CNS, you will provide high quality, evidence based care to patients with bowel cancer throughout their cancer treatment journey.

Key Responsibilities
* Support patients through diagnosis, treatment and follow‑up, ensuring holistic and compassionate care.
* Prepare cases for the colorectal multi‑disciplinary meetings (MDT), ensuring data completion and accuracy.
* Complete Macmillan holistic needs assessments and signpost patients to appropriate services.
* Collaborate with the wider MDT to optimise patient outcomes.
* Contribute to service development, initiatives and quality improvement.
* Provide education and training to patients, relatives and junior members of staff.
* Maintain professional standards, act as a role model and work collaboratively with MDT members.
* Provide specialist advice and support to ensure the delivery of high quality and efficient services.
